Introduction & Heritage of Bishop's Stortford Football Club
Founded in 1874, Bishop's Stortford Football Club boasts a rich history that intertwines with the development of regional football in Hertfordshire. Nestled in a market town with a storied past, the club has long served as a pillar of local sports culture, fostering community spirit and nurturing talent for nearly 150 years. Originally established to provide a platform for local enthusiasts to enjoy the beautiful game, Bishop's Stortford quickly grew into an integral part of the English football landscape. Stadium & Infrastructure: The RDA Stadium
The RDA Stadium stands as a modest but vibrant home for Bishop’s Stortford Football Club, situated in the heart of Hertfordshire. With a capacity of 4,525, this grass-surface venue provides an intimate yet spirited atmosphere during matchdays. Its compact design fosters close-up engagement between players and supporters, creating a true community vibe that defines the club’s identity. Over the years, the stadium has undergone several updates to enhance safety and comfort, yet it retains its traditional charm, serving as a symbol of local pride.
